我要求在图表上显示销售,前两个月的访客等统计数据,当然图例应显示两个月的名称。 我决定将商店桌子设计为: 1) 产品Jan Feb
随着时间的推移,和1月2月可以更改为3月,4月。所以,对于这个设计,每个月,列名都会改变,我认为数据集不能自动绑定。这是对的吗?
2)设计如下: 产品M1 M2
M1,M2代表上个月,当选择时,使用月份名称的列别名,但在这种情况下,数据集列也会随着时间的推移而改变,我不认为SSRS图表可以绑定列名称将更改的数据集。
那么,如何处理这样的要求,有没有更好的方法呢? 我目前使用ssrs2005,ssrs2008可以处理这个吗?
答案 0 :(得分:0)
所以,对于这个设计,每个月,列名都会改变,我认为数据集不能自动绑定。这是对的吗?
正确。
M1,M2代表上个月,当选择时,使用月份名称的列别名,但在这种情况下,数据集列也会随着时间的推移而改变,我不认为SSRS图表可以绑定列名称将更改的数据集。
数据集列如何随时间变化?随着M3,M4等的增加?在这种情况下,最好的解决方案是按原样旋转表:Product,Month,Amount。
如果您无法更改表格,则必须使用动态SQL语句在数据集查询中自行轮换表格。您可以在系统表中查询列列表,汇编SELECT语句并执行它。
答案 1 :(得分:0)
您应该右键点击图表中的系列字段,请参见下面的图像